Creating a limited URL services is an interesting project that consists of numerous components of software package growth, like Internet enhancement, databases management, and API style and design. Here's a detailed overview of the topic, that has a give attention to the critical components, difficulties, and ideal techniques involved in developing a URL shortener.

one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a way online wherein a lengthy URL may be transformed right into a shorter, additional workable kind. This shortened URL redirects to the initial prolonged URL when frequented. Expert services like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-recognized examples of URL shorteners. The need for URL shortening arose with the appearance of social websites platforms like Twitter, where character boundaries for posts manufactured it tough to share extended URLs.

Outside of social media marketing, URL shorteners are helpful in promoting campaigns, e-mails, and printed media the place prolonged URLs can be cumbersome.

two. Core Parts of the URL Shortener
A URL shortener normally is made of the following elements:

Website Interface: This is actually the front-conclusion section where customers can enter their long URLs and receive shortened versions. It can be a straightforward sort on the Online page.
Database: A database is necessary to shop the mapping in between the original extended URL and also the shortened Edition.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L selections like MongoDB can be used.
Redirection Logic: This is the backend logic that requires the brief URL and redirects the user to the corresponding lengthy URL. This logic is usually carried out in the net server or an application layer.
API: Many URL shorteners present an API so that 3rd-bash purposes can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the initial prolonged URLs.
3. Developing the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ing an extended URL into a short 1. A number of approaches might be employed, like:

Hashing: The long URL may be hashed into a set-dimension string, which serves since the shorter URL. However, hash collisions (distinct URLs causing precisely the same hash) should be managed.
Base62 Encoding: 1 frequent solution is to utilize Base62 encoding (which takes advantage of sixty two people: 0-9, A-Z, and also a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ds to the entry while in the databases. This technique makes certain that the brief URL is as quick as is possible.
Random String Technology: A further approach is to create a random string of a set duration (e.g., 6 figures) and Examine if it’s by now in use inside the database. If not, it’s assigned for the very long URL.
4. Database Management
The databases schema for just a URL shortener will likely be uncomplicated, with two Major fields:

ID: A singular identifier for each URL entry.
Lengthy URL: The first URL that should be shortened.
Quick URL/Slug: The limited Variation in the URL, generally saved as a unique string.
As well as these, you might like to retail outlet metadata such as the development date, expiration date, and the number of situations the quick URL has long been accessed.

5. Dealing with Redirection
Redirection is a vital Component of the URL shortener's Procedure. Any time a user clicks on a short URL, the assistance ought to quickly retrieve the original URL through the databases and redirect the person utilizing an HTTP 301 (long lasting redirect) or 302 (momentary redirect) position code.

Performance is essential listed here, as the procedure needs to be nearly instantaneous. Tactics like databases indexing and caching (e.g., making use of Redis or Memcached) is usually employed to hurry up the retrieval process.

6. Protection Considerations
Safety is an important concern in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ener is often abused to distribute malicious backlinks. Applying UR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-celebration safety expert services to examine URLs before shortening them can mitigate this threat.
Spam Avoidance: Amount restricting and CAPTCHA can prevent abuse by spammers attempting to make 1000s of brief URLs.
7. Scalability
Because the URL shortener grows, it may have to manage an incredible number of URLs and redirect requests. This demands a scalable architecture, quite possibly invol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ute targeted visitors throughout many servers to take care of significant hundreds.
Distributed Databases: Use databases that could sc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Independent considerations like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into distinct providers to enhance sc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ners normally deliver analytics to trace how often a brief URL is clicked, where by the website traffic is coming from, together with other valuable metrics. This needs logging Every redirect And maybe integrating with analytics platforms.
